  • Patent number: 4045472
    Abstract: The novel urethane polythiols of this invention are prepared by reacting: (a) a mono-, di-, or trihydric polythiol with a polymeric isocyanate; or (b) a di- or trihydric polythiol with a diisocyanate.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: December 15, 1975
    Date of Patent: August 30, 1977
    Assignee: W. R. Grace & Co.
    Inventors: James Leverette Guthrie, Clifton Leroy Kehr
